  • Abstract
    According to the shortcomings of existing forest monitoring method and the short communication distance of existing wireless sensor node for forest environmental monitoring, a new-style node based on AT86RF230 was designed. In this design, micro-controller is ATMega128L, radio frequency chip is AT86RF230, and a folded dipole is used. The effective communication distance of wireless sensor nodes in open field is 200m, and that is 85m in the planted forest, fully satisfying the needs of forest environmental monitoring.
